The Role of Polyolefin Elastomers in Automotive Lightweighting
The demand for flexible, durable, and versatile materials has grown significantly in various industrial sectors across the United States. One such material gaining widespread recognition is polyolefin elastomers (POEs), which combine the elasticity of rubber with the processing advantages of plastics. The US Polyolefin Elastomers Market is witnessing considerable expansion as industries seek materials that meet stringent performance and environmental criteria.
Polyolefin elastomers are polymers synthesized primarily from ethylene and propylene, with specialized catalysts enabling tailor-made molecular structures. This results in materials offering excellent flexibility, toughness, and chemical resistance. POEs are used extensively in automotive parts, packaging, consumer goods, and construction materials.
The automotive industry is a significant consumer of polyolefin elastomers due to their lightweight properties, impact resistance, and ability to improve fuel efficiency by reducing vehicle weight. Packaging applications leverage POEs for stretch films, sealing layers, and impact modifiers, enhancing product protection and sustainability.
Innovations in polymerization techniques have enabled manufacturers to create POEs with customizable mechanical and thermal properties, further expanding their application scope. Moreover, the recyclability and low carbon footprint of POEs align well with the growing emphasis on sustainability.
Nevertheless, challenges such as fluctuating raw material prices and competition from alternative elastomers persist. Manufacturers are investing in research and strategic partnerships to improve cost efficiency and product quality.
